CNC Machinist
On-siteBirmingham, Alabama, United States
Job Summary
Setup, run, and inspect mission-critical aerospace components using advanced 5-axis machines and mill-turn centers, leveraging deep manual machining fundamentals to troubleshoot chatter and optimize tool pressure. Establish offsets, build workholding strategies, and read/edit G-code and M-code on the floor to maximize throughput and restore quality. Hold tight tolerances from the first piece through final inspection using manual micrometers, indicators, and precision gauges, while independently conducting First Article Inspections (FAI) and operating CMMs. Troubleshoot dimensional, tooling, and machine variables on the fly to achieve first-article success on both proven and unproven parts. Required Qualifications
- 7+ years in precision, tight-tolerance machining
- Strong tenure in Aerospace manufacturing and machining environments
- Experience in ISO 9001 or AS9100 shops
- Proven ability to hold .0005" (5 tenths / ~13 microns) or tighter on critical features
- Manual skills to verify .0005" tolerance
- Deep understanding of complex blueprints and advanced GD&T (true position, parallelism, profile, concentricity, flatness, coaxiality)
- Extensive experience setting up multi-axis equipment (5-axis mills, mill-turns, and/or multi-axis lathes)
- Comfortable in shops where setup time is 30%+ of the job
- Comfortable handling complex setups with 10+ tools
- Ability to read, understand, and efficiently edit G-code and M-code on the floor
- Ability to troubleshoot dimensional, tooling, and machine variables on the fly
- Ability to achieve first-article success on both proven and unproven parts
